1978 Simca 1307 vs. 1988 Volvo 440
To start off, 1988 Volvo 440 is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1978 Simca 1307.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1978 Simca 1307 would be higher. At 1,721 cc (4 cylinders), 1988 Volvo 440 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1988 Volvo 440 (109 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 42 more horse power than 1978 Simca 1307. (67 HP @ 5600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1988 Volvo 440 should accelerate faster than 1978 Simca 1307.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1978 Simca 1307 weights approximately 20 kg more than 1988 Volvo 440.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1988 Volvo 440 (143 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 40 more torque (in Nm) than 1978 Simca 1307. (103 Nm @ 2800 RPM). This means 1988 Volvo 440 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1978 Simca 1307.
Compare all specifications:
1978 Simca 1307 | 1988 Volvo 440 | |
Make | Simca | Volvo |
Model | 1307 | 440 |
Year Released | 1978 | 1988 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1294 cc | 1721 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 67 HP | 109 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 5800 RPM |
Torque | 103 Nm | 143 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2800 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 76.7 mm | 81 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 70 mm | 83.5 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.5:1 | 10.5:1 |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1040 kg | 1020 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4260 mm | 4320 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1690 mm | 1720 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1410 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2610 mm | 2510 mm |
